Gorilla Sushi is a fantastic late night eatery on Tropicana and Spencer. Inside is lively with awesome music playing a genre mix of R&B and Korean songs. Atmosphere has a busy vibe, it was packed! There was seating available at the bar. They offer AYCE Lunch $25.99 from open until 3pm, and AYCE Dinner $29.95 from 3pm until closing. Menu has a great selection of appetizers, soup, nigiri sushi, gorilla sashimi, standard cut & hand roll, chef special roll, baked roll, deep fried roll, and desserts. I chose a la carte and ordered my go-to for King Kong Roll (6 pieces, $10.95), it's deep-fried roll, inside has shrimp tempura, opt for non-spicy crab, has cream cheese, drizzled with yum yum sauce and eel sauce, so delicious! I noticed they make kimbap too! They have bulgogi and buldak. I asked for Original (6 pieces, $3.99) and requested deep-fried kimbap. The sushi chef is so cool! He made kimbap nice and crispy, inside has soft fried tofu, shredded carrots, burdock, pickled radish, all very tasty! I asked for yum yum sauce (+$0.25), this goes exceptionally well with any deep-fried food. Also had Miso Soup ($3.00), it was simple, served hot, and comforting. They give a good serving of soft tofu and green onions, though it would be great if wakame seaweed was added in to enhance it. 2.5 stars. I have no idea why this place has as many good reviews as they do. We went here for the AYCE sushi but decided to go a la cart. I'm glad that we did because the rolls were just average. Nothing to write home about. They were busy on a Thurs night and we had to wait around 10 mins to get seated. There isn't much place to wait inside, so we stood outside. This isn't a big deal at night but if you come here during the day, it might be a wait in the heat. The ambiance is casual, sports bar with a few booths. We ordered the Call 911 roll, the Kiss of Fire, the Spicy salmon roll, the Takoyaki, the Unagi sushi and a Hot sake. We love spicy food so a lot of our decision-making was based on the number of spice stars next to the rolls. The Call 911, which had 5 spice stars next to it and was recommended by the server as their hottest, was nowhere close to being spicy. In fact, the Kiss of Fire, which had 3 stars, had more of a kick. The server ended up getting us some spicy Korean sauce to heat things up. The rolls overall were ok. Same thing with the spicy salmon roll. It was fine. Nothing to write home about. The Takoyaki and the Unagi were just disappointing. Unlike the usual Takoyaki, these were half balls instead of full balls. They also didn't have the bonito flakes and the octopus was more pureed than diced. The Unagi looked nicer than it tasted. Instead of tasting the rice and the eel as a combination, it amalgamated into one melted bite, which wasn't as fun. The sake was fine. All in all, this was a very average dining experience and we will look for alternatives when we come back to Vegas next time.
